Can I convert my wood-burning fireplace to gas?
Yes, and in Marshall the terrain is the story. Homes cling to steep hillsides, and downtown's narrow buildings stack against the mountainside — tight lots that complicate chimney routing and draft. A wood-to-gas conversion, especially to a sealed direct-vent unit that vents out a sidewall instead of up a difficult chimney, often solves a draft problem the old fireplace never could.
Direct-vent gets around a bad chimney
Marshall's setting works against traditional venting. The French Broad gorge brings cool, damp evenings, and the surrounding ridges, valleys, and tall trees cause downdrafts that make an open masonry fireplace draft poorly and even backpuff smoke into the room. A sealed direct-vent gas unit changes the equation: it uses sealed combustion and runs a coaxial pipe straight out a sidewall, so it does not depend on the existing chimney at all — a real advantage on a tight downtown lot where lining or reaching the old flue is awkward. It is often the go-to for a home whose fireplace never drafted right.
Gas or propane, confirmed on a steep site
Marshall is mixed fuel. Some homes tie into a main; many others, up the hollows and out toward Walnut and the Mars Hill Road, run on propane, which needs its own orifices and pressures or it will soot. We confirm your fuel before we spec the unit. Access matters here too — on a steep hillside lot we plan up front how the crew and materials reach the firebox, so the install goes smoothly rather than becoming a scramble on the day.
